Kingofpain89 wrote:Someone decided to sell off their Stephen Marsh character sheet from one of Stormberg's auctions:


** expired/removed eBay auction **




Most importantly it includes a set of character sheets for Illysia Morningstar, a character mentioned in the back of the Dungeon Masters Adventure Log and in Steve's Alarum's & Excursion articles and possibly in a few of the Wild Hunt articles. This character was a mainstay in Steve's D&D games when he was a player. She was also used as an important NPC in later games DMed by Steve.
